Here's one that you don't see come up for sale very often (at least I haven't) and it's NIB. Just as it originally came from Schrade.
Its my understanding that the SCHRADE 51OT knives were only made from 1978 to 1980 so I guess that makes this somewhat rare.
Here are the specs:
3-3/4" extremely sharp schrade 1095 high carbon drop point spear blade with Schrade USA and 51OT tang stamp. 4-3/4" closed length, lockback design, Beautiful brown sawcut delrin handles with nickel silver old timer inlay shield. Bright polished nickel silver bolsters with solid brass pins and liners. Old timer monogram leather belt sheath . Comes in the original woodgrain box with original paperwork.
